Originally published in 1923, “Riceyman Steps” is a novel by British novelist Arnold Bennett, winner of that year’s
James Tait Black Memorial Prize for fiction.



Set in a quiet London square in the 1920s, just after the First World War, “Riceyman Steps” tells the powerful story of Henry Earlforward, a miserly book dealer, and the consequences of his decision to marry Violet Arb, who owns the confectionery shop across the square.
